Title

Psychologist - Specialized Orthopedic and Developmental Rehab Team  

Category Healthcare Professional Opportunities  
Req Number HEA-19-00019  
Open Date 4/22/2019  
Number of Openings 1  
Department Specialized Orthopedic and Developmental Rehab 

Work type Regular Part-time 

Grade Grade 9B ($48.85/hr to $61.20/hr) 

FTE 0.1 

Posting Close Date 05/22/2019 

Description

Status: Regular Part Time (0.1 FTE); 4 hours a week

Key Responsibilities

  • In partnership with clients/families and the interdisciplinary team, provides client and family-centred care which is goal directed, evidence based and outcome oriented
  • Bases practice on psychological science relevant to psychology from other sciences and humanities
  • Supports and respects the client/family’s rights to make decisions based on their own values, beliefs and experiences
  • Demonstrates a spirit of inquiry by examining current practice and identifying questions for study and research
  • Delivers care based on established policies and procedures
  • Collaborates with the client/family to assess, plan, and provide a diagnosis documenting the process according to professional standards and hospital policy with respect for the client’s right to confidentiality
  • Ensures that psychological practice and professional issues are addressed using appropriate lines of communication
  • Documents on client charts and accurate workload statistics
  • Communicates in a timely and effective manner with families and interdisciplinary team members
  • Participates in appropriate education and training sessions
  • Supervises psychology practicum and internship students
  • Demonstrates accountability for own psychology practice by adhering to established professional practice standards
  • Participates in quality improvement initiatives, supports the maintenance of a safe and healthy work environment and advances a culture of client/patient safety through work and daily practices
  • Participates in program evaluation as part of clinical practice
  • Some evening & weekend work may be required

Qualifications

  • PhD in Psychology and Registration with the College of Psychologists in Ontario required with declared competencies in Clinical Psychology with children and adolescents
  • Previous job related experience working with children and families required
  • Declared competency in family therapy preferred
  • Trauma informed care/trauma focused therapy is preferred
  • Knowledge and experience in Cognitive Behavioural Therapy is essential
  • Works effectively as a member of the interdisciplinary team
  • Demonstrates ability to organize time and meet deadlines
  • Demonstrates initiative and self direction
  • Demonstrates ability to effectively and efficiently manage fluctuating clinical responsibilities
